Road disrupted as Melamchi pipeline bursts at Thapathali (photos/video)

A Melamchi drinking water pipe has burst in Thapathali, Kathmandu, resulting in floods and a large crater in the road.

The road from Thapathali Chowk toward Paropakar Maternity and Women's Hospital has been blocked due to the crater created by the flood.

A large flood flowed from Thapathali Chowk toward the maternity hospital after the pipeline burst. Although the water flow has subsided, vehicles cannot pass through the road due to the large crater.

Security personnel from Kathmandu Metropolitan City including traffic and city police are currently working at the site.

The cause of the pipe burst in Thapathali is unknown. Ashok Kumar Paudel, Chief Executive Officer of Kathmandu Upatyaka Khanepani Limited (KUKL), stated that preparations are underway to repair the pipe and resume water distribution.

"The water supply pipeline has burst. We will determine the cause of the burst and start water distribution after repairing the pipe," he said.

Earlier on February 12, a Melamchi drinking water pipe burst in Babarmahal, Kathmandu, causing inundation in the Babarmahal area.
